Top 5 Companies in the Food Distributors Industry With the Lowest Revenue Per Employee (WILC, SPTN, UNFI, SYY, NAFC)
Jan 08, 2013 (SmarTrend(R) News Watch via COMTEX) --
Below are the three companies in the Food Distributors industry with the lowest Revenue Per Employee (RPE). Analysts use RPE as a measure to compare the productivity of companies in the same industry.G Willi-Food International ranks lowest with a an RPE of $305,000. Spartan Stores is next with a an RPE of $643,000. United Natural Foods ranks third lowest with a an RPE of $835,000.
Sysco follows with a an RPE of $932,000, and Nash Finch rounds out the bottom five with a an RPE of $1.1 million.
